About the Item
With flame stitch upholstery with wear. The arched backs and scrolled carved arms, square seat raised on os de mouton legs and conforming stretchers. Seats rerailed.
- Dimensions:Height: 47.75 in (121.29 cm)Width: 25.75 in (65.41 cm)Depth: 30.25 in (76.84 cm)Seat Height: 19 in (48.26 cm)
- Sold As:Set of 2
- Style:Louis XIV (Of the Period)
- Materials and Techniques:
- Place of Origin:
- Period:1700-1709
- Date of Manufacture:1700
- Condition:Repaired: One chair with old splice to rear legs. Not noticeable unless examined very closely. Seat: 19 H.
